Samenvatting
Simulations of lattice QCD including two degenerate light flavours (up, down) and a non-degenerate quark pair (strange, charm) are currently being performed by the European Twisted Mass (ETM) Collaboration. The inclusion of nf = 2+1+1 flavours is an important step in order to move towards a fully realistic situation.

We (the applicants), have played a major role in this collaborative effort, and many intermediate results have been published and presented at major conferences. However, this work is not yet complete.

Dedicated simulations are required to perform the non-perturbative renormalization of operators in a mass-independent scheme. We have already validated the method of calculation and preliminary results have been presented.

The computer time we request for this PILOT is intended to allow us to verify the full program chain on Huygens, anticipating a full request to compute all the required ensembles and renormalization constants at beta=1.90.
